This is more than just a daycare job. It’s a journey, where you learn, grow, thrive—and play—every day. Being a teacher at a child care center is something special. We’re hiring and we want difference makers who will inspire children to become lifelong learners. As a Teacher, you are:
- Caring! Follow all licensing guidelines and company standards to ensure the daily care of every child in your classroom.
- Engaged! Develop your ability to accurately observe, assess, and plan for children, as well as effectively communicate with families.
- Knowledgeable! Complete extensive training that provides insight on child care, preschool and development topics.
- Creative! Implement our proprietary curriculum while creating fun, interactive learning experiences for the children. Additional Information Help for Additional Information. Opens a new window. Additional Information Help for Additional Information. Opens a new window.
We want energetic, dependable, passionate individuals who are at least 18 and have: - Experience in a licensed childcare center or related field.
- The ability to meet state requirements for education and our center requirements.
- Able to work indoors or outdoors and engage in physical activity with children.

Learning Care Group, Inc. is North America’s second-largest for-profit childcare provider and a leader in early childhood education. We offer specialized programs for children from 6 weeks to 12 years, delivered through our unique family of brands. Our commitment to excellence drives us to create cutting-edge facilities, equipped with advanced technology and expertly crafted curriculum designed by our in-house Education team. Our Promise We strive to make a meaningful impact on every child, their families, and the communities we serve. From infants to school-age students, our comprehensive, research-based curriculum supports holistic child development in a safe, nurturing, and engaging environment. As experts in childcare and early education, we prepare children for school, instill a lifelong love of learning, and build a strong foundation for their future success
